- [ ] **Step 7: Breaker override escrow.** After sealing the signing keys for the Tallgrove upstream API circuit breaker, confirm the support team can force the breaker open during a full outage. The override bundle lives in the sealed escrow drawer and is useless without its unlock phrase. Two ceremony witnesses must initial this step before proceeding. The escrow bundle is decrypted with the recovery passphrase that follows.

vault phrase of kahip-kahop = holath-quenmir

Handover — Gallery Labels, Marrowfield Museum

To the dispatch desk: the printed labels for the new Tidewrack Gallery arrived from Quillstone Print this afternoon, checked against the curator's master list twice. All 42 labels are flat-packed between acid-free boards in the blue portfolio case. Please keep the case horizontal at all times; the foil lettering scuffs easily. Collection by Lanthorn Couriers is scheduled for 8:15 tomorrow. Pass on the following instruction at hand-over.

dispatch memo: the lamwyn fenwyn courier leaves the wenir ledger at gate 7175 under passcode 822969

// Heads up, reviewer: Paystride changed their export format in v4,
// so this client now requests the new columnar payroll feed instead
// of the old CSV dump. The parser downstream expects the v4 schema —
// don't revert this without also reverting the parser. Auth against
// our internal LedgerHub proxy is required; the key it expects is below.

gateway credential: kto3_qfe

### Onboarding: Catalogue Import Job

The Winthorpe Library catalogue import runs nightly, pulling MARC records from the consortium feed into the Lantern database. The job is deployed as a signed container; the Hobbes scheduler refuses anything unsigned, so don't try to shortcut it during local testing either. Future maintainers should rotate credentials annually. The deploy key used by the import pipeline is:

rollout seal: bky9_aBG1gvAyU